Portability issues, README.md improved with Ubuntu requirements to make easier the...
[anna.git] / SConstruct
index d811f34..14f7f15 100644 (file)
@@ -17,10 +17,15 @@ target_opt_bin = os.path.join (opt_bin, "anna")
 # Versioning
 release = ARGUMENTS.get ('release', 0)
 
+# Environment
+env = Environment ()
+oracle_includes = os.environ['ORACLE_HOME'] + "/include"
+        
 # Headers
 source_include = os.path.join (current_directory, "include")
 usr_include = [
-  "/usr/include/oracle/11.2/client",
+  #"/usr/include/oracle/12.1/client64",
+  oracle_includes,
   "/usr/include/libxml2",
   #"/usr/include/boost",
   #"/usr/include/mysql", 
@@ -31,12 +36,12 @@ usr_include = [
 libraries = []
 
 # Environment
-env = Environment ()
+#env = Environment ()
 # CPPPATH will be relative to src/<target>
 env.Append (CPPPATH = [source_include, usr_local_include, usr_include ])
 env.Append (CCFLAGS = '-std=c++0x')
 # C++11 support:
-env.Append (CXXFLAGS = '-std=c++11')
+#env.Append (CXXFLAGS = '-std=c++11')
 
 env.Append (LIBS = [''])
 # scons -Q release=1